COVID-19 Surveillance and Exposure Testing in School Communities

This is a prospective, observational study of COVID-19 surveillance and exposure testing in school communities. Participating school communities are providing sever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2) tests to students and staff at their schools per school, local, and national guidelines. This study will combine data received from the schools with data collected directly from participants to guide analysis of the co-primary objectives. Participants will be grouped into two different cohorts, depending on each school's SARS-CoV-2 test administration practices.

Surveillance Cohort: Schools participating in this cohort will be performing surveillance testing weekly on approximately 10-20% of students and 100% of staff.

Exposure Cohort: Schools participating in this cohort will be performing exposure testing on students and staff who have been identified as having close contact with school members diagnosed with SARS-CoV-2 infection.

Treatment and study plan

Primary outcomes

  1. Evaluate secondary transmission/prevalence of SARS-CoV-2 in Kindergarten through 12th grade schools in the Surveillance Cohort.

    Time frame: 2 years

    Proportion of students/staff with positive SARS-CoV-2 test identified by surveillance testing.

  2. Evaluate secondary transmission/prevalence of SARS-CoV-2 in Kindergarten through 12th grade schools in the Exposure Cohort.

    Time frame: 2 years

    Proportion of students/staff with positive SARS-CoV-2 test following within-school exposure.

  3. Describe return to school outcomes in Kindergarten through 12th grade schools in Surveillance Cohort.

    Time frame: 2 years

    Proportion of students who return to in-person education in Fall 2021, Spring 2022, and Fall 2022 from participating schools conducting surveillance testing compared to districts without testing.

  4. Describe return to school outcomes in Kindergarten through 12th grade schools in Exposure Cohort.

    Time frame: 2 years

    Mean time to return-to-school after SARS-CoV-2 exposure in the month after initiation of the school-provided testing program compared to the month prior to initiation of the school-provided testing program.
